2. Emulator Compatibility
The capacity to successfully play a digitally acquired version of Pokmon Stadium on a device hinges critically on emulator compatibility. An emulator serves as a software bridge, enabling a system to mimic the hardware of the original Nintendo 64 console. Variances in emulator design and capabilities directly impact the game’s performance and playability.
-
Core Accuracy
Emulator core accuracy pertains to how faithfully the software replicates the Nintendo 64’s processor and system architecture. High accuracy emulators prioritize precision, aiming to execute the game code as intended by the developers. In the context of a digitally acquired Pokmon Stadium, a highly accurate core minimizes glitches, ensures proper rendering of graphics, and facilitates correct audio reproduction. Lower accuracy cores may lead to visual distortions, sound errors, or even game crashes. Project64, for instance, offers varying levels of core accuracy depending on its configuration, influencing the resulting gameplay experience.
-
Plugin Support
Many N64 emulators utilize plugins to handle graphics and audio processing. The selection of appropriate plugins is crucial for optimizing Pokmon Stadium‘s visual fidelity and sound quality. For example, the Glide64 plugin offers enhanced texture filtering, improving the game’s appearance. Similarly, specific audio plugins address potential sound glitches that may arise from the emulator’s core. The presence of robust plugin support and configuration options allows for customization, accommodating a range of hardware capabilities and user preferences.
-
Hardware Requirements
Emulator compatibility extends beyond software; the host device’s hardware plays a pivotal role. Running Pokmon Stadium requires sufficient processing power (CPU), graphical processing capability (GPU), and memory (RAM). Emulation introduces overhead, demanding more resources than the original console. Attempting to run the game on a device with inadequate specifications can result in sluggish performance, frame rate drops, and overall diminished gameplay. A system capable of smoothly running modern games generally provides a more favorable emulation experience.
-
File Format Support
Compatibility also refers to the specific ROM file formats that an emulator recognizes. A Pokmon Stadium ROM may exist in different formats (e.g., .z64, .v64, .n64). The chosen emulator must support the particular format of the acquired file. Incompatibility results in the emulator failing to load the game, rendering the ROM unusable. Ensuring that the emulator recognizes the ROM format is a fundamental step in achieving a functioning setup.

5. File integrity verification
The verification of file integrity is a critical step following the acquisition of a digital copy of Pokmon Stadium for the Nintendo 64. This process aims to confirm that the downloaded file is complete, unaltered, and free from corruption, ensuring the game functions as intended and mitigating potential security risks.
-
Checksum Calculation and Comparison
Checksums, such as MD5, SHA-1, or SHA-256 hashes, are unique digital fingerprints generated from a file’s content. A reliable source providing the Pokmon Stadium ROM should also publish its checksum value. After obtaining the file, checksum calculation software can be employed to generate a hash of the downloaded file. Comparison of this calculated hash with the published value verifies the file’s integrity. A mismatch indicates potential corruption or tampering. For example, if a file is altered, even by a single bit, the calculated checksum will differ significantly from the original, flagging it as potentially unsafe.
-
Source Trustworthiness and Verification Protocols
The reliability of the source providing the checksum value is as crucial as the checksum itself. Checksum values published by untrustworthy sources could be fabricated to mask a corrupted or malicious file. Reputable ROM repositories often employ verification protocols, involving multiple independent sources confirming the checksum values. Such protocols enhance confidence in the integrity of the published checksum. For instance, a collaborative effort among multiple independent ROM collectors to verify checksums provides a more robust assurance than relying on a single, potentially biased, source.

7. Preservation Efforts
Preservation efforts, in the context of digitally acquiring Pokmon Stadium for the Nintendo 64, address the challenges of maintaining access to and playability of a classic video game as original hardware and software become increasingly scarce. The digital acquisition, though often legally ambiguous, can be viewed as a component of a broader movement focused on ensuring the longevity of video game history.
-
Archival of ROM Images
One facet involves the archival of ROM images. Dedicated communities and individuals meticulously catalog and preserve game ROMs, including Pokmon Stadium. This action ensures that the digital representation of the game is not lost to time, despite the obsolescence of the original cartridge format. These archives, however, often exist in a legal gray area, as unauthorized distribution of copyrighted material remains a concern. The Internet Archive, for instance, hosts some retro games, but the legal permissibility of such actions is often debated and subject to takedown requests from copyright holders.
-
Emulator Development and Maintenance
Emulators are crucial for playing archived ROM images. Preservation efforts include the development and ongoing maintenance of these emulators to ensure compatibility with evolving operating systems and hardware. Open-source projects like Project64 actively work to refine the accuracy and performance of Nintendo 64 emulation, thus enabling continued access to Pokmon Stadium on modern devices. Without these efforts, the archived ROM would be unplayable.
-
Documentation and Reverse Engineering
Preservation extends beyond merely storing the ROM. Documentation and reverse engineering projects seek to understand the inner workings of the game and the original hardware. This knowledge is invaluable for creating more accurate emulators and for preserving the historical context of the game’s development. Websites like “The Cutting Room Floor” document unused content and development secrets found within games, contributing to a deeper understanding of titles like Pokmon Stadium.
